Knowing the nucleus : the nuclear constituents and characteristics
Nuclear global properties
General nuclear radioactive decay properties and transmutations
Nuclear interactions : strong, weak and electromagnetic forces
General methods
Alpha-decay : the strong interaction at work
Beta-decay : the weak interaction at work
Gamma decay : the electromagnetic interaction at work
Nuclear structure : an introduction
The liquid drop model approach : a semi-empirical method
The simplest independent particle model : the Fermi-gas model
The nuclear shell model
Nuclear structure : recent developments
The nuclear mean-field : single-particle excitations and global nuclear properties
The nuclear shell model : including the residual interactions
Nuclear physics of very light nuclei
Collective modes of motion
Deformation in nuclei : shapes and rapid rotation
Nuclear physics at the extremes of stability : weakly bound quantum systems and exotic nuclei
Deep inside the nucleus : subnuclear degrees of freedom and beyond
Outlook : the atomic nucleus as part of a larger structure
Units and conversion between various unit systems
Spherical tensor properties
Second quantization - an introduction
